Abstract

The utility model relates to an antifog goggles convenient to adjust, include: the anti-fog glasses comprise a mounting frame, an anti-fog lens, a first mounting side shell, a second mounting side shell, a head band, a mounting screw and a locking cap, wherein a first cavity is formed in the first mounting side shell; a second cavity is formed in the second mounting side shell, and a second screw hole communicated with the second cavity is formed in the outer side of the second mounting side shell; the outer part of the locking cap is provided with an external thread matched with the second screw hole, and the inner part of the locking cap is provided with an internal screw hole matched with the mounting screw rod; the installation screw rod is movably arranged on the second installation side shell through a locking cap, one end of the head band is fixed on the first installation side shell, and the other end of the head band extends into the second cavity and is wound on the installation screw rod. The anti-fog goggles are convenient to adjust, simple and convenient to operate, good in anti-fog, comfort and ventilation effects and high in practicability.

Detailed Description
To make the objects, technical solutions and advantages of the present application more clear, embodiments of the present application will be described in further detail below with reference to the accompanying drawings.
Referring to fig. 1-3, the present application provides an anti-fog goggles that are easy to adjust, including: a mounting frame 4, an anti-fog lens 13, a first mounting side shell 1, a second mounting side shell 7, a head band 12, a mounting screw 10 and a locking cap 9, wherein,
the first mounting side shell 1 and the second mounting side shell 7 are symmetrically arranged at two ends of the mounting frame 4; the anti-fog lens 13 is fixed at the bottom of the mounting frame 4; a first cavity is arranged in the first mounting side shell 1; a second cavity is arranged in the second mounting side shell 7, and a second screw hole communicated with the second cavity is formed in the outer side of the second mounting side shell.
Referring to fig. 2, the locking cap 9 is externally provided with an external thread engaged with the second screw hole, and internally provided with an internal screw hole engaged with the mounting screw 10; the mounting screw 10 is movably arranged on the second mounting side shell 7 through a locking cap 9, and one end of the mounting screw 10 extends into the second cavity. One end of the headband 12 is fixed to the first mounting-side housing 1, and the other end thereof extends into the second cavity and is wound around the mounting screw 10.
When the safety goggles are worn, the mounting frame 4 and the anti-fog lenses 13 are integrally covered on the eye areas of a user, the head circumference of the user is bound tightly through the head bands 12, and the safety goggles are fixedly worn on the head of the user; the head circumference sizes of different users are different, the headband is required to have an adjusting function, when the headband is adjusted, the locking cap 9 is unscrewed to be separated from the second mounting side shell 7, the mounting screw 10 is rotated to roll or unreel the headband 12, the length of the headband 12 is changed to adapt to the head circumferences of the different users, and after the headband 12 is adjusted to the proper length, the locking cap 9 is screwed down to be fixed on the second mounting side shell 7; therefore, the wearing and adjusting operations of the anti-fog goggles are simple and convenient, and the practicability is high.
Furthermore, the first mounting side shell 1 and the second mounting side shell 7 are vertically fixed at the side end of the mounting frame 4 through screws, and the mounting frame 4 and the mounting side shells are of a split structure, so that the manufacturing, the mounting and the replacement of accessories are convenient.
Further, the anti-fog lens 13 is fixed below the front end of the mounting frame 4; the rear end of the mounting frame 4 is arranged into an arc shape which is matched with the shape of the forehead of a wearer; referring to fig. 3, the bottom middle part of the anti-fog lens 13 is set to be curved to fit with the shape of the bridge of the nose of the wearer, when the anti-fog lens 13 is worn, the anti-fog lens 13 is abutted against the bridge of the nose of the wearer, the head of the wearer is tied up by the headband 12, the forehead of the wearer is tightly attached to the rear end face of the mounting frame 4, and the wrapping protection of the eye region of the wearer. Set up a plurality of vertical bleeder vents 5 between the front end of mounting bracket 4 and the rear end, specifically can set to the matrix and arrange, improve the ventilation effect when this goggles wears.
Further, the method also comprises the following steps: the power supply 2 and the illuminating lamp 3 are electrically connected with the power supply 2, and the power supply 2 is arranged in the first cavity and can be a storage battery; the light 3 sets up on the top of mounting bracket 4, can be convenient for throw light on the place ahead under the condition that there is the fog on the one hand, and on the other hand has the effect of warning.
Further, the insides of the first installation side shell 1 and the second installation side shell 7 close to the face of the wearer are provided with soft pads, specifically, the soft pads can be sponge soft pads 6, the first installation side shell 1 and the second installation side shell 7 are prevented from directly extruding skins on two sides of the head to generate extrusion pain, and the wearing comfort is improved.
Further, the method also comprises the following steps: and a twist handle 11 fixed to the other end of the mounting screw 10 for facilitating the rotation operation of the mounting screw 10.
As a preferred embodiment, the front end faces of the first mounting-side case 1, the second mounting-side case 7 and the mounting bracket 4 are flush; the bottom end surfaces of the first mounting-side case 1 and the second mounting-side case 7 protrude beyond the bottom end surface of the mounting frame 4 to cover the side areas of the wearer's eyes. As another preferred embodiment, both sides of the anti-fog lens 13 are respectively bent to extend out side lenses, the top of the side lenses abuts against the bottom end surface of the first mounting side case 1 or the second mounting side case 7, and the side lenses can cover the side areas of the eyes of the wearer.
Consequently, the antifog goggles structure of this application is ingenious, and concrete good regulation performance, cooperation and bandeau 12 adjust easy operation convenience, antifog lens 13 and bleeder vent 5 set up and effectively avoid the use in fog shelter from the sight, and the inboard fixed sponge cushion 6 of installation side shell guarantees good travelling comfort of wearing.
